AΜΝΑ signs memorandum of cooperation with Athens Chamber of Commerce & Industry

The Athens-Macedonian News Agency (AMNA) has signed a memorandum of cooperation with the Athens Chamber of Commerce & Industry (ACCI) for the promotion of entrepreneurship.
The memorandum was signed by the president of ACCI, Sofia Kounenaki Efraimoglou, and the president and general manager of AMNA, Emilios Perdikaris.
In particular, within the framework of the cooperation, AMNA will assume the role of "Media Partner" of the largest chamber of the country and the two bodies, among other things, will cooperate:
- for the promotion of the actions of ACCI and its member companies in the Greek and international media,
- for the information and training of ACCI members on communication and promotion issues,
- for the preparation and implementation of collaborations with European and international organizations, academic, research and technological institutions and public bodies, including the possibility of joint submission of proposals to European or other programs, aiming at their modernization and development.
Furthermore, AMNA will offer a discount on promotion, communication and publicity services to ACCI members.
"Our partnership with the Athens-Macedonian News Agency aspires to give greater visibility and momentum to Greek businesses. To convey the pulse of business activity to a wider domestic and international audience," Efraimoglou said in her speech.
The president also noted that this partnership "creates added value for ACCI members - and in particular for small and medium-sized enterprises, which are in greater need of guidance and support in communication matters.
In particular, within the framework of the cooperation, all member companies of the chamber gain more economical access to a series of promotion, communication and publicity services."
She added that "at the same time, we will jointly seek further possibilities for wider synergies in order to better promote the goals of both ACCI and AMNA.
I am optimistic that this partnership will be particularly creative and fruitful. With tangible benefits for businesses, for the economy and for the development of the country."
The president underlined that "by joining forces with the country's national news agency, we create, on the one hand, a strong communication channel that connects ACCI and its member businesses with important groups of people in Greece and all over the world and on the other hand, we facilitate the access of businesses to services with a critical role for their extroversion."
On his part, the president and general manager of the Athens-Macedonian News Agency, Emilios Perdikaris said: "The signing of the memorandum of cooperation with ACCI is an extremely important moment for the Agency, as it seals the agency's extroversion and strategic choice to collaborate with equally extroverted and dynamic organizations. This is more important as ACCI represents the most innovative and productive forces of the country. Of particular importance is the fact that the relationship between AMNA and ACCI, based on the cooperation memorandum, is bidirectional and not imbalanced. In particular, as far as AMNA is concerned, ACCI will now be our valuable advisor and ally in the effort to modernize our organization and familiarize it with the market and the modern economy, but also to potentially claim funds through European programs. Finally, the role of AMNA as 'Media Partner' of ACCI is not only limited to the publicity services it will provide to the members of the chamber or the journalistic coverage of its activities. The aim is to conduct joint information activities and events related to entrepreneurship and innovation."
